区块链协议的差异
区块链协议的差异主要表现在以下几个方面:
-
共识机制:
- 工作量证明(PoW):比如比特币使用的协议,通过解决复杂的数学问题来验证交易并创建新的区块。这种机制的优点是安全性高,但缺点是能耗极大。
- 权益证明(PoS):如以太坊即将采用的协议,它通过持币量和持币时间来选择创建区块的节点,能有效降低能耗。
- 委托权益证明(DPoS):比如EOS使用的机制,通过选举少数代表来进行区块的产生,效率高但中心化程度较高。
示例:我在之前的项目中,我们选择了使用PoS机制来开发我们的区块链平台,因为它在保证安全的同时,显著降低了运行成本。
-
可扩展性:
- 链上扩展:如比特币的SegWit协议,它通过优化区块数据结构来提高网络的处理能力。
- 链下扩展:如闪电网络,它通过建立链下交易渠道来实现高速交易。
示例:在参与开发一个支付系统时,我们整合了闪电网络技术,显著提升了交易速度,处理了高峰时段的交易拥堵问题。
-
治理模型:
- 链上治理:如Tezos,持币者可以直接投票决定链上政策和升级。
- 链下治理:如比特币,通过社区讨论和共识形成决策。
示例:在我之前的项目中,我们设计了一种链上治理机制,使得每个持币者都能直接参与到协议的更新与调整中,增强了社区的凝聚力。
-
安全性与隐私:
- 普通区块链:如比特币,所有交易信息公开透明。
- 隐私保护区块链:如Zcash,采用零知识证明等技术,保护交易双方的隐私。
示例:在处理涉及个人隐私的数据时,我们采用了类似Zcash的加密技术,确保用户信息的安全与保密。
通过这些不同的技术选择和设计理念,各种区块链协议能够适应不同的业务需求和环境,从而在各自的领域中发挥最大的效能。在选择区块链协议时,我们通常需要考虑其安全性、效率、成本以及适用场景等多个因素。
2024年8月14日 20:30 回复